Wunderkind Teams Up with Cordial to Advance Autonomous Marketing and Cross-Channel Engagement

Wunderkind Partners with Cordial

Wunderkind and Cordial have introduced a powerful AI marketing integration to improve cross-channel engagement and customer personalization. The partnership combines advanced identity resolution with intelligent messaging capabilities. As a result, brands can better understand users and deliver tailored experiences across multiple channels.

Additionally, AI marketing adoption helps marketers identify anonymous visitors and convert them into useful customer profiles. It uses behavioral signals to enable personalized, real-time interactions with customers. This means that customers can be contacted through emails and SMS.

“Most brands lose the majority of their website traffic to anonymity before they ever have the opportunity to engage, and lack the flexibility to immediately engage a customer based on their intent, ” said John Bates, CPO at Wunderkind. “Our integration with Cordial changes that. Wunderkind recognizes more shoppers, and through our context layer and AI decisioning, then recommends who to reach, what type of message to deliver, and when. From there, Cordial’s AI predictive models decide how to branch journeys and further personalize experiences across channels. Together, we’re helping brands unlock more value from the platforms they already rely on.”

Enhancing Customer Engagement Through AI-Powered Personalization

Moreover, Wunderkind introduces its own identity graph and AI-based decisioning solutions to the partnership. The latter is augmented by the former’s orchestration engine and predictive AI models. The combination makes it possible for marketers to increase their reach while keeping their workflows the same.

Moreover, the integration allows for high intent signals such as cart abandonment and price changes. This means that the brands can deliver messages to customers in a timely manner. It also allows for compliance through subscription preferences in Cordial’s system.

“Today’s marketers don’t need another platform to manage; they need more value from the platforms they already have,” said Bates. “By combining Wunderkind’s behavior intent and identity data and autonomous decisioning with Cordial’s AI predictive models, AI-native CDP and orchestration, we’re enabling brands to recognize more customers, personalize every interaction, and deliver measurable business outcomes with far less manual effort.”

In addition, the use of standardized processes may help brands become more efficient operationally. There is no need to build campaigns from scratch since one can personalize the experience and use automation. Consequently, integrating AI into marketing enables businesses to maximize their existing technology investments while reducing operational time.

“Brands using Cordial’s AI predictive models are already increasing revenue per message by 50%,” said Matt Howland, President at Cordial. “Layering Wunderkind’s de-anonymization on top of Cordial’s messaging platform and AI-native CDP means brands can reach more customers, perform better on every message, and drive more revenue.”
